Feature Karin Karma
Definition schwedischer weiblicher Vorname Hauptglaubenssatz im Hinduismus, Buddhismus und Jainismus; das spirituelle Konzept, dass jede (physische und geistige) Handlung unweigerlich Folgen hat, die sich durch Schicksalsschläge während des weiteren irdischen Lebens ausdrücken oder/und die Form der Wiedergeburt (in der Hölle oder auf der Erde; als Mensch, Tier oder Pflanze) bestimmen; die Summe der nach diesem Prinzip bewerteten Handlungen
